Cells stored at low state-of-charge can drop below 3.0V, triggering deep-discharge protection that blocks normal startup until a slow trickle charge restores the cell above the recovery threshold.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eBattery percentage jumping after replacing the SA10120 cell\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e SA10120 Roady uses a voltage-threshold method to estimate remaining charge rather than a fuel gauge IC with coulomb counting. After a cell swap, the device has no baseline for the new cell's voltage curve, so the indicator reads erratically until it recalibrates. Run the battery down to near-empty, then charge it to full in one uninterrupted session. After one or two complete cycles the percentage reading stabilises.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eSatellite radio playback cutting out before the battery indicator shows empty\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e SA10120's audio output stage and RF tuner draw higher current than the idle display alone. Near the end of discharge, cell voltage sags under that combined load even though the resting voltage still reads above the empty threshold. The device shuts off to protect the cell before the indicator reaches zero. If this happens consistently, the cell voltage under load is dropping below 3.2V — a full recharge cycle should push the cutout point back toward the end of the charge curve.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43381336539226,"sku":"BWCS-DXM120SL-1","price":34.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43381336571994,"sku":"BWCS-DXM120SL-2","price":40.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43381336604762,"sku":"BWCS-DXM120SL-3","price":44.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-DXM120SL_1.webp?v=1778899987","url":"https:\/\/batteryweb.com\/products\/delphi-xm-satellite-radio-sa10120-roady-replacement-battery-37v-3600mah-li-ion","provider":"BatteryWeb","version":"1.0","type":"link"}
